Night Shift Operations Clerk
Job Purpose:
Ensure loading and offloading of products from/into the cold store/trucks as per instruction without compromising of Food Safety or Quality.
Assist Shift Manager with the effective running of department by fulfilling daily duties and achieving set targets.

Key Responsibilities:
• General admin duties.
• Responsible for the Warehouse integrity.
• Ensure stock is correctly allocated as per stock system.
• Ensure the weight and number of cartons are correct before loading in/off.
• Ensure that the correct product and quantity is loaded.
• Ensure the stock being loaded is in good condition.
• Ensure documentation is correct/corresponding.
• Ensure orders follow through as planned.
• Ensure Receiving/Dispatch area remains clean at all times.
• Ensure that all Sales Orders are picked from the Reach Truck report and given to the shift managers.
• Ensure all local drivers’ PODs are returned daily.
• Ensure that all Problem Orders and queries on the Reach Truck report are sorted.
• Ensure that all weekly and monthly leave forms are filled in and update leave register.
• Ensure that all containers are offloaded and sent back on time.
• Ensure all GRVs are booked on the system.
• Ordering of truck seals.
• Ensure all files are up to date.
• Ensure that all Credits (returns) are written in the book and sent to the relevant people.
• Ensure problem orders on SAP are communicated to the relevant people.
